Job Summary

Job Description

As an Applied Scientist at Apple, you will be involved in cutting-edge research in data mining and machine learning, specifically focusing on anomaly detection and automated machine learning. Your primary responsibilities will include conducting research, driving projects from ideation to validation, improving core manufacturing ML capabilities, and supporting ML software engineers in translating successful approaches to production code. You will also train MLEs to apply these methods to factory use cases. This role requires a passion for innovation and the ability to contribute to the development of extraordinary products and services.
Must have:
  • Experience in data mining and machine learning

With the explosive growth of Apple products we are creating new opportunities for individuals to work on the most exciting new technologies at Apple The Product Operations machine learning team is seeking an Applied Scientist in data mining and machine learning to conduct research in anomaly detection and automated machine learning to address domain-specific challenges in manufacturing multi-modal data that includes time-series, graph and tabular data Research scientists on our team drive projects from ideation to validation, with the goal of improving our core manufacturing ML capabilities. They support ML software engineers in translating successful approaches to production code, and train MLEs to apply them to factory use cases.
